Output 53fac294640b8e8d2d1b6c0e1122c9355e2e9d6e9a65853d0b98134fb930496a:0

value
18767044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8634a2caf25b3a5950296ea602778cd70f775473 OP_EQUAL
address
3DvdXTQdj2bQCgkaSuiwrn5uY3jSLL8gdq
transaction
53fac294640b8e8d2d1b6c0e1122c9355e2e9d6e9a65853d0b98134fb930496a
spent
true